RE: The tariff classification of women's pajamas with matching carrying bag from Hong Kong

Dear Ms. Riggs:

In your letter dated August 16, 2002, you requested a ruling on tariff classification. The sample submitted with your request will be returned to you under separate cover.

Style 25103015 consists of a pair of women’s pajamas composed of knit and woven components and a matching flannel carrying bag. The pajama top is constructed from 100 percent cotton knit fabric and the pajama bottom and carrying bag are constructed from 100 percent cotton flannel woven fabric. The pajama top features long sleeves, a round neckline, embroidery on the bodice and a hemmed bottom. The neck and sleeve edges have a crochet trim. The pajama bottom features an elasticized waist and long hemmed legs. Neither the knit nor the woven fabric provides the essential character to the pajamas. Therefore, in accordance with General Rules of Interpretation 3(c) they are classified under the heading that occurs last in numerical order, that is, heading 6208, HTS. These garments have been designed and will be marketed as sleepwear and will also be imported under style number 25103035 which is identical in style to the submitted pajamas but differing in print.

The pajamas will be imported in, and sold with a matching flannel carrying bag. The envelope styled bag is approximately 13 inches long by 11 inches high and features a flap with a button and loop closure. The pajamas and carrying bag are considered composite goods in accordance with General Rules of Interpretation 3(b). The essential character is provided by the garment, therefore, the pajamas and the carrying bag will be classified under the HTS number for the pajamas.

The applicable subheading for style 25103015 will be 6208.21.0020,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TS), which provides for women’s or girls’ singlets and other undershirts, slips, petticoats, briefs, panties, nightdresses, pajamas, negligees, bathrobes, dressing gowns and similar articles: nightdresses and pajamas: of cotton: other. The rate of duty will be 9 percent ad valorem.

Style 25103015 falls within textile category designation 351. Based upon international textile trade agreements products of Hong Kong are currently subject to quota restraints and the requirement of a visa.

The designated textile and apparel categories and their quota and visa status are the result of international agreements that are subject to frequent renegotiations and changes. To obtain the most current information, we suggest that you check, close to the time of shipment, the U.S. Customs Service Textile Status Report, an internal issuance of the U.S. Customs Service, which is available at the Customs Web site at www.customs.gov. In addition, the designated textile and apparel categories may be subdivided into parts. If so, visa and quota requirements applicable to the subject merchandise may be affected and should also be verified at the time of shipment.
